Output 6b21cdbbd4fa425026daa113d4ece895bc5044040afa30bbd7325a604e0cc59d:0

value
1531187550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bfa07cf31f9683e7001704e4dd097f0071b4175 OP_EQUAL
address
AFQbnxpbqaoBcrHTjovXkmv1P7RrbigvC9
transaction
6b21cdbbd4fa425026daa113d4ece895bc5044040afa30bbd7325a604e0cc59d